Q: Is 10,503,315 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 10,503,315 is not a prime number.

Why is 10,503,315 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 10503315 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 9 15 45 233,407 700,221 1,167,035 2,100,663 3,501,105 and 10,503,315, with no remainder.

Since 10,503,315 cannot be divided by just 1 and 10,503,315, it is not a prime number.
